Deliberate attempt made to burn down Batadrava police station's documents, files: Assam Police

On Monday, new details about the Batadrava violence emerged, with police officials claiming that a deliberate attempt was made to burn down the police station's documents and files.

Prior to torching the police station, a group of people were seen setting fire to files containing important documents. According to police, an infamous drugs lord named Lalu from Dhing in Assam was seen on video throwing stones at the police station.

According to reports, he is the mastermind behind the drugs ring in Dhing, Nagaon district. He was identified from video footage of the violent incidents that occurred in Batadrava on Saturday.

However, police have stated that Lalu is still on the run and that they are working to apprehend him. Meanwhile, police arrested another suspect in the incident after recognising him in surveillance footage.

Sultan Ali, a resident of Salaguri village in Dhing, has been identified. He has been detained for questioning, according to police, while investigations into the incident's other perpetrators continue.
